Tool Overviews
NordVPN is the market-leading consumer VPN, used by over 14 million people. Its 6,400+ server fleet spans 111 countries, with specialised servers for P2P, double VPN, and Onion over VPN. The PwC-audited no-logs policy and Panama incorporation make it one of the most privacy-credible options on the market. Threat Protection (a built-in ad and malware blocker) works even when the VPN tunnel is off. Streams Netflix US/UK/JP, Disney+, BBC iPlayer, and Max reliably.
Windscribe is a Canadian VPN notable for its genuinely useful free tier (10GB/month, 14 locations in 11 countries) and its Build Your Own Plan, which lets privacy-minded users handpick specific server locations at $1/location/month. Open-source desktop and mobile clients. The ROBERT filter blocks ads, malware, and tracker domains at the DNS level. Windscribe is a Five Eyes jurisdiction (Canada), which privacy purists may want to note. Pro plan unlocks unlimited data and all ~110 locations.
Pricing in Detail
NordVPN has three plan lengths — 2-year ($3.39/mo), 1-year ($4.99/mo), and monthly ($12.99/mo). All plans include the same feature set. The Basic tier (listed above) is VPN-only; Plus ($4.49/mo 2-yr) adds an ad blocker and password manager; Ultimate ($6.49/mo 2-yr) adds cloud storage.
Windscribe offers three options: Free (10GB/mo, no credit card required), Pro ($9/mo monthly or $5.75/mo annual — unlimited data, all locations), and Build Your Own ($1/location/month — pay only for the server countries you actually use). Build Your Own is genuinely unique and ideal for users who only need a handful of locations.
For most users comparing on price alone: NordVPN Basic 2-year ($3.39/mo) is cheaper than Windscribe Pro annual ($5.75/mo) and includes far more servers.
Privacy & Jurisdiction
This is where the gap is most significant. NordVPN is incorporated in Panama, which has no mandatory data retention laws and is outside the Five Eyes, Nine Eyes, and Fourteen Eyes intelligence-sharing alliances. Its no-logs policy has been independently audited three times by PwC, with full report published. RAM-only servers mean no data survives a physical seizure.
Windscribe is a Canadian company — Canada is a Five Eyes member and subject to intelligence requests. Windscribe has published a transparency report and their clients are open-source (auditable), but their server-side no-logs status has not been independently verified by a major auditor. For high-risk use cases, NordVPN's jurisdiction is meaningfully stronger.
For everyday privacy (ISP tracking, public Wi-Fi, geolocation), both are more than adequate.
Streaming Performance
NordVPN is one of the top three streaming VPNs on the market. It reliably unblocks Netflix US, UK, Japan, and Canada, BBC iPlayer, Disney+, Max, Hulu, and Paramount+. SmartPlay technology automatically routes streaming through optimised servers without manual server-switching.
Windscribe unblocks Netflix and some Disney+ libraries, but performance varies by server load. Some users report having to switch servers manually to find a working Netflix connection. For casual geo-unblocking it works; for reliable, set-and-forget streaming, NordVPN is the safer pick.
